首页 > 其他 > 详细

12 locust 主要参数及分布式

时间:2021-01-28 18:03:13      阅读:25      评论:0      收藏:0      [点我收藏+]

1 主要参数

执行命令:locust -f runlocust.py --no-web -c 10 -r 2 -t 1m --csv=index
--no-web 不进行页面监控,节省客户端资源
-c 设置虚拟用户数
-r 设置每秒启动虚拟用户数
-t 设置设置运行时间
--csv=index 以CSV格式存储当前请求测试数据。测试数据保存在此文件相同目录

2 分布式

分布式:master 和每一台 slave 机器,在运行分布式测试时都必须要有 locust 的测试文件。
master:locust -f runlocust.py --no-web -c 10 -r 2 -t 1m --master
slave:locust -f runlocust.py --no-web -c 10 -r 2 -t 1m --slave --master-host=‘master host’
--expect-slaves=X
如果在没有Web UI的情况下运行Locust,在启动主节点时加上--expect-slaves指定选项,以指定预期连接的从节点数。
然后,在开始测试之前,将等待这些从属节点连接。

 

12 locust 主要参数及分布式

原文:https://www.cnblogs.com/lizitestdev/p/14338033.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!